Broccoli soupDead simple, tasty20 minutesThis is based off a Gordon Ramsey recipe. It's ridiculously simple, and the color is insane. The texture of the soup is creamy thick, and very smooth.

IngredientsBroccoli (one head makes 3-4 servings)
Salt (optional) Pepper (optional) Cheese (optional) Olive oil (optional) Curry powder (optional) DirectionsGet a pot of water boiling, and add some salt to the water.
Cut the broccoli florets off the stalk, rinse them, and drop them into the boiling water. Cover the pot, and let them boil for 3-4 minutes, until the broccoli is still crunchy, but easy to cut through. Filter the broccoli out and reserve the water. Put the broccoli into a blender, and add enough water so that you can blend the broccoli smooth. If you want to spice it up with curry powder, add it in the blender. Blend until thoroughly smooth, and serve. Drizzle olive oil or melt some cheese on top. The fat in the oil/cheese gives an extra flavor that really makes it delicious. |
